3D Systems announced the immediate availability of the next-gen RapMan 3.2 3D printer kit from Bits from Bytes. RapMan 3.2 includes new features that make it easier to own and operate, including an intuitive touchscreen interface and USB file storage.
The desktop sized printers include a 25-way D-sub connector with a screw terminal that eliminates the need for a soldering iron, 2kg of material (both white ABD and clear PLA), and an additional filament reel holder. Models can be designed in any 3D CAD program, then converted into G-code. Files can be read directly from an SD card.
